How Couples Therapy Works and Session Frequency

How does couples counseling work? It is fundamentally about improving communication cycles and fostering mutual understanding rather than assigning blame. Initially, couples often attend therapy sessions once per week. How often do couples attend counseling sessions, and how long does couples therapy take? While the duration varies—ranging from a few months to a year or more—the frequency allows for consistent application of learned skills between appointments. This consistency is crucial for foundational changes in behavior and perspective.

Practical Considerations: Cost, Insurance, and Commitment

When considering marriage counseling San Diego residents frequently inquire about the financial commitment. What is the cost of couples counseling sessions? Rates for services like couples counseling San Diego vary widely based on the therapist’s experience, location, and session length. While some providers may offer sliding scale fees or package deals, the question arises: Is couples counseling covered by insurance? Many insurance plans offer limited or no coverage for marriage counseling San Diego or relationship issues, as it may not be considered medically necessary mental health treatment. This means many clients pay out-of-pocket, making it essential to understand the fee structure upfront.

Common Questions About Starting Therapy

There are many reasons to see a therapist in San Diego. If you aren’t happy with the direction your life is taking, talking with a therapist can help you find direction. If you have been trying to change patterns in your life and haven’t had success, a psychologist in San Diego can help you find the tools to move forward. Talking with a therapist can give you the freedom to express yourself in a safe space and can give you the tools to find balance in your life.

Experiencing grief and trauma are two reasons for seeking out a therapist. Psychotherapy in San Diego helps you to process the aftermath of traumatic events like the death of a loved one. There are many ways to cope with the impact of trauma and grief. Psychotherapy in San Diego provides a space for you to understand your experience and move forward at the pace that is right for you.

Psychotherapy in San Diego can also help when you are experiencing conflict at work or in relationships. It’s common for there to be occasional disagreements at work and with your partner or friends. When those disagreements become frequent or start impacting your job performance, counseling in San Diego, CA can help. Talking with a psychologist in San Diego helps you identify ways to resolve and avoid conflict. Through therapy, you can also develop the tools you need to maintain healthy relationships.

Meeting with a therapist in San Diego is the best way to decide if the therapist is a right match for you. During your first session, you and your therapist will get to know each other. The first session is a chance for you and your therapist to ask each other questions and learn how you can work together with a counselor in San Diego toward creating a more balanced life. Prepare ahead of your first appointment with a therapist in San Diego by having a clear list of goals in mind. Approach your first session with an understanding of what you’d like to get out of your relationship with your therapist. It is easier to discover the right therapist for you when you can clearly describe symptoms and desired goals during your session. If you have your priorities clear when seeking counseling in San Diego CA, you and your therapist will be able to better decide if you are a good match. When considering a psychologist in San Diego, you should also think about things like gender, religion and other important relationship factors. Select a therapist that represents values important to you and you will increase your success in finding the right therapist for you.
You can expect the first appointment with a therapist in San Diego to be a time of introduction between you and your therapist. It’s a great time to ask your therapist questions and decide if you are comfortable with your therapist. If you don’t feel like you are a good match with your therapist, you can use the time to discuss another counselor in San Diego that could be a better match for you. It could be a good idea to schedule some free time before and after your first session to give yourself time to process your time with your therapist. During your first session with a psychologist in San Diego, you’ll answer questions that will allow your therapist to learn your history. It’s important for therapists to learn about your past so together you can make progress toward your future. Through discussions about your history, your therapist could be able to identify patterns or triggers that are impacting your life today. Counseling in San Diego CA also helps develop tools to lessen the impact negative patterns and triggers have on your life. You can be sure what you say in therapy is confidential because there are laws that ensure patient confidentiality when talking with a therapist in San Diego. Therapists who break confidentiality are subject to punishment by the State Licensing Board and are vulnerable to lawsuits from their clients. It’s in the best interest of both you and your therapist to maintain confidentiality through your sessions.

Therapists also swear an oath of confidentiality when they finish training and begin working with clients. So, when you are talking with a psychologist in San Diego what you discuss is confidential, unless there is mention of something dangerous to yourself or others. Therapists allow partners or loved ones in your individual therapy sessions if it is helpful for establishing history. A psychologist in San Diego will also bring in another person to help resolve a specific issue that is blocking you from achieving your goals. It is also helpful to bring a guest into your individual therapy session if that person has been involved in past patterns or has known you for a long time.

An old friend or current partner can help provide perspective when talking with your therapist.

In general, sessions with a therapist in San Diego are individual, unless you’re seeking couples counseling. Talking with a therapist alone allows you to build a relationship based on trust, mutually working toward the goal of creating a path forward in your life. Individual counseling also guarantees complete confidentiality, which allows you to speak more openly.
